Description
As an internal security consultant for the UK&I region, you will manage all-rounded information security projects and activities including:
1. Risk Management: risk register, risk assessment, 3rd party risk, remediation plan, mitigation
2. Security Engagement: Manage relationships of tech and non-tech stakeholders
3. Incident Response: improve the incident response process, work with the incident response team
4. Security projects and programs delivery
5. Business Resilience
6. Product Security: respond to client enquiries about security of software/products
7. Security culture and awareness
